Changes for version 0.03 - 2026-03-19

  • Require -from in select()
  • Allow empty -where and -having clauses
  • Validate WHERE operators and reject unknown ones
  • Operators are case-insensitive, rendered as uppercase
  • Deduplicate select arg-parsing into Select->from_args
  • Replace all inline require with use

Documentation

Modules

Composable SQL query builder with expression trees